What Is Kitchen Cabinet Refacing?
Refacing is essentially giving your kitchen a “new skin.”
The bones of your kitchen stay in place, but the visible surfaces—doors, drawer fronts, handles, panels and trims—get completely replaced.
Think of it like upgrading your phone case instead of buying the latest model.
You get the fresh look… without the shock-to-the-wallet feeling.
Many Sydney homeowners choose refacing when:
-
Their kitchen layout still works
-
The cabinet frames are structurally good
-
They want a modern look, fast
-
They’re planning to renovate the bathroom or laundry next and want to keep the budget flexible
-
They’re preparing a property for sale in areas like Ashfield, Strathfield, Ryde, Chatswood or Parramatta, where small visual upgrades often deliver big buyer interest

2. Faster turnaround time
A full kitchen renovation often takes weeks and may require:
-
demolition
-
plumbing and electrical rework
-
retiling
-
appliance changes
-
new stone fabrication
-
council/strata approvals (sometimes)
Refacing skips almost all of that.
Most jobs are completed within days, depending on size and material selection.

4. Huge style flexibility
Refacing lets you choose:
-
matte or gloss finishes
-
timber or timber-look textures
-
modern profiles (shaker, V-groove, flat panel)
-
new hinges and soft-close systems
-
upgraded handles and hardware
-
wraps, laminates, poly or polyurethane finishes
This is what makes refacing feel like a full renovation—because visually, it is.
The kitchen ends up looking like it was ripped out and rebuilt.

When Kitchen Cabinet Refacing Is the Best Choice
Refacing is ideal when:
-
Your cabinet frames are structurally good
-
Your layout works for your lifestyle
-
You want a fast visual upgrade
-
You want to manage renovation costs
-
You want minimal downtime
-
You need a property-ready refresh for sale or rental

When a Full Kitchen Renovation Might Be Better
At MB9, we’re honest.
Refacing isn’t right for every home.
A full renovation is better when:
-
You want to change the layout
-
The cabinet carcasses are water-damaged
-
Plumbing/electrical upgrades are required
-
You’re planning a full home renovation
-
You want new stone benchtops with a different configuration
